Section 8: Functions of Regional Centre.

The Regional Centre for Biotechnology Act, 2016.Central Act · Act 36 of 2016

The functions of the Regional Centre, shall be—

(a) to establish infrastructure and technology platforms which are directly relevant to biotechnology education, training and research;

(b) to execute educational and training activities including grant of degrees in education and research in biotechnology and related fields;

(c) to produce human resource tailored to drive innovation in biotechnology, particularly in areas of new opportunities and to fill talent gap in deficient areas;

(d) to undertake research and development and scientific investigations in collaboration with relevant research centres in the region;

(e) to hold scientific symposia and conferences within India or in the region or outside the region and to conduct short-term and long-term training courses and workshops in all areas of biotechnology;

(f) to collect universally available information with a view to setting up data banks for bioinformation;

(g) to collect and disseminate, through networking, the relevant local knowledge in the field of biotechnology, ensuring protection of intellectual property rights of local stakeholder communities;

(h) to develop and implement a policy for intellectual property rights which is equitable and just to the stakeholders involved in research in the Regional Centre;

(i) to disseminate the outcome of research activities in different countries through the publication of books and articles;

(j) to promote collaborative research and development networking programme in specific areas of biotechnology with national, regional and international networks and promote exchange of scientists, at the regional level having regard to issues pertaining to intellectual property rights of collaborating institutions promoting equitable sharing of benefits with collaborating institutions.
